By the way, only way to identify the number of teeth is by either counting
them, or by looking with a magnifying glass at the top of the plastic gear
for numerals identifying the number of teeth (20 = 20 teeth). I have found
that the color coding indicated in the parts book (specific color plastic
for specific tooth count) is for the birds and not to be depended on.
However, if you really want to know, the 20 tooth unit is SUPPOSED to be
green, and the 21 tooth unit is supposed to be gray .
